SEAN DORSEY DANCE PREMIERES NEW WORK AT 2017 HOME SEASON

BOYS BITE BACK is an evening of powerful performance on navigating queer & trans masculinities – featuring new works by Sean Dorsey Dance with guest artists The Singing Bois and Amir Rabiyah.

Sean Dorsey Dance‘s all-new dances offer a sneak peek of the company’s upcoming show BOYS IN TROUBLE (premieres in April 2018). As the shadow of Tr*mp’s rule falls over LGBTQ communities across the US, Sean Dorsey Dance bites back with full-throttle dance, luscious queer partnering, highly-physical theater and storytelling that celebrate expansiveness and reject compulsory conformity.

In turns explosive, powerful, playful, vulnerable and sexy, these new dances underline why Sean Dorsey Dance has been called “epic …powerful, moving, hilarious” (Miami Herald), “trailblazing” (San Francisco Chronicle), and “evocative, compelling, elegant” (LA Weekly).

BOYS BITE BACK also features two special guest artists: The Singing Bois are a queer retro quartet – part boy band, part Rat Pack, they twist gender expectations with musical precision; guest performer Amir Rabiyah is a queer, trans, mixed race, disabled, poet and storyteller.
